Output 93b280590c80dc5a5dc06eb2e8bb07ba1e08deebafb7cd93eeb381b2833c025b:0

value
426930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c1eba64b02ebd7fd9073faeeba6b38ee958ff40 OP_EQUAL
address
38dW69aAMfbiSnAskPnrqvY1zZZiLSg1Yk
transaction
93b280590c80dc5a5dc06eb2e8bb07ba1e08deebafb7cd93eeb381b2833c025b
confirmations
169168
spent
true